wrote on Jul 6, 2023, 10:13 AM last edited by@LoudLemur said in Since update css broken?:
it looks like Cloudron kept all the configurations I had made too (e.g. subscribed sub-Reddits).
Cloudron actually does save nothing.
Teddit is per design privacy focused on a maximum.
Nothing you do while using Teddit is stored or saved server side. It all happens client side in your browser using cookies etc.
Only what you configure in the config.js is being saved server side. -
